No Duties and Responsibilities This position requires a bachelor’s degree in information technologies or equivalent experience with at least 4 years of experience in the field or related experience. 3+ years of business or systems analyses experience. 3+ years of experience with systems implementation including configuration of application modules, process workflows, and application-specific coding. Working knowledge of business processes related to higher education and/or research. Excellent written and oral communication skills are required. Must be able to work as a team member in varied project settings. Must be able to work independently with light direction from team or project leads. Must be able to manage time commitments and meet deadlines. Position Tasks: Perform moderately complex system analyses necessary to implement required application, system, or solution (30%). Configure, develop, and/or instantiate required applications, systems or solutions (35%). Document and communicate application (or module) functional specifications and revised solutions (15%). Assist in application/system testing and troubleshooting (10%). Participate in functional unit, research, technical and staff team meetings (5%). Other duties as assigned (5%). Certificates/Credentials/Licenses Certifications in relational database and web technologies – preferred. Desired Computer Skills: Familiar with relational database concepts and tools including SQL and SQL developer tools. Experience with web application and client/server application concepts including web server/application server architecture, APIs and HTML / XML / JSON. Knowledge of project management. Ability to utilize normal Microsoft office applications (Word, Excel, Outlook, Visio, Teams). Ability to use Visual Code Studio and code repositories (e.g., GitHub, VSS, etc.). Experience with application programming interfaces (APIs). Experience with application query tools and report writers. Experience with workflow engines.
